What is the difference between credentialing and licensing?

Licensing refers to the process of securing the authority to practice medicine within a state.

Credentialing refers to the process of verifying the provider’s license, education, insurance, and other information to ensure they meet the standards of practice required by the hospital or healthcare facility.21
